Nevertheless, the President can not single-handedly remove the EB-5 programthis calls for an act of Congress. The EB-5 program was originally created in 1990 and later strengthened by the RIA in 2022. Because it is codified in the Immigration and Race Act (INA), any kind of initiative to rescind or modify the program would certainly require the flow of brand-new regulation via both chambers of Congress.

Under the EB-5 Reform and Integrity Act (RIA), the EB-5 Regional Center (RC) program is licensed via September 30, 2027. This means that unless Congress reverses, customizes, or replaces the program, it will continue to be effectively until that day. Even more, Congress has specifically suggested financial investment quantities for EB-5 and that can not be transformed by exec order or policy.

Sec. 2. The Gold Card. (a) The Assistant of Commerce, in coordination with the Secretary of State and the Assistant of Homeland Protection, shall develop a "Gold Card" program licensing an alien who makes an unlimited gift to the Division of Commerce under 15 U.S.C. 1522 (or for whom a corporation or similar entity makes such a gift) to establish eligibility for an immigrant visa making use of an expedited procedure, to the level constant with legislation and public safety and national protection this worries.
(b) In settling visa applications, the Secretary of State and the Assistant of Homeland Security shall, regular with applicable law, deal with the present specified in subsection (a) of this section as proof of eligibility under 8 U.S.C. 1153(b)( 1 )(A), of remarkable business capability and national advantage under 8 U.S.C. 1153(b)( 2 )(A), and of eligibility for a national-interest waiver under 8 U.S.C.
